LATE drama sees Andy Slory denied his full Albion debut.
The Dutch winger was set to replace the cup-tied Frank Nouble on the left wing but injured his heel in the warm-up.
Robert Koren steps up from the bench and 17-year-old Kayleden Brown is drafted in as a substitute.
Roberto Di Matteo makes three changes in total to the side that beat Scunthorpe 2-0 in midweek.
In defence Gianni Zuiverloon and Abdoulaye Meite come in, with Gonzalo Jara pushed into central midfield and Gabriel Tamas rested on the bench.
Youssouf Mulumbu also becomes a substitute as Simon Cox comes into the middle of the park on his first return to his former club.
Albion Academy product Sam Mantom, who turns 18 next Saturday, is handed an early birthday present as he is named among the subs.
George Thorne is the man to make way in the dugout as he is on England Under-17s duty.
Brian McDermott makes two changes to the Royals side that beat Plymouth 2-1 four days ago.
Matt Mills and Jimmy Kebe come in for Zurab Khizanishvili, who is left out altogether, and Simon Church, who drops to the bench.
READING (4-5-1): Federici; Griffin, Ingimarsson, Mills, Bertrand; McAnuff, Howard, Karacan, Gunnarson, Kebe; Long. Subs: Hamer (gk), Tabb, Henry, Church, Robson-Kanu, Rasiak, Pearce.
ALBION (4-5-1): Carson; Zuiverloon, Meite, Olsson, Mattock; Brunt, Cox, Jara, Dorrans, Koren; Bednar. Subs: Kiely (gk), Brown, Moore, Wood, Tamas, Mulumbu, Mantom.
REFEREE: C Foy (Merseyside).
